Description

Quality Learning Center in Minneapolis, with a missing N, was closed due to suspected fraud, but reopened hours later. Independent journalist Nick Shirley exposed daycares receiving millions in taxpayer funds without clear legitimate operations. Despite claims of closure, at least twenty kids arrived at the center. Owners son, Ibrahim Ali, denies fraud, attributing it to a misunderstanding. This case highlights the challenges in tracking public funds, sparking concerns about potential misuse.
